Preview: West Ham United vs. Aston Villa

West Ham kick off their season back in the top flight against Aston Villa, who begin a new era under manager Paul Lambert.

West Ham United begin their first season back in the top flight with a clash against Aston Villa at Upton Park tomorrow.

Hammers boss Sam Allardyce has a host of new signings to consider for the match, including goalkeeper Jussi Jaaskelainen, Alou Diarra, Mohamaed Diame and Modibo Maiga, who could all contest for a starting spot.

Jack Collison is expected to miss out on his side's opener due to a knee injury that was aggravated in pre-season, while skipper Kevin Nolan should be fit to lead his side out after overcoming a toe problem.

Meanwhile, all eyes will be on new Villa boss Paul Lambert, who could start new boys Karim El Ahmadi and Ron Vlaar but will have to deal with the club's early injury woes.

The Scottish boss has been forced to deal with the losses of Marc Albrighton, Gabriel Agbonlahor and Richard Dunne, who all face lengthy spells on the sidelines due to their respective injury problems.

Possible lineups:

West Ham: Jaaskelainen; Demel, Reid, Collins, O'Brien; Tomkins, Diame, Noble, Vaz Te; Maiga, Cole

Aston Villa: Given; Lichaj, Clark, Vlaar, Bannan; Ireland, El Ahmadi, Delph, N'Zogbia; Bent, Weimann

Sports Mole says: 1-1
